Exciting News About Amanda Stevens!


One of my favourite American authors is finally going to be published in the UK!
I am soooo excited!

Last year I gobbled up The Abandoned and The Restorer (prequel and first book in The Graveyard Queen series) by Amanda Stevens. If you click on the titles you will see my gushing review. I was desperate for  a publisher in the UK to pick  up the series and finally they have!

 The Restorer will be released  by  MIRA on 7th September 2012 in the UK, with The Prophet due for release on 3rd March 2013. They are currently scheduled for both paperback and e-book release, although may become a digital exclusives.

The digital only prequel The Abandoned will be released on 3rd August 2012 in the UK too.
